Strathmore Capital Advisors Inc. Takes $864,000 Position in Simon Property Group, Inc. $SPG

Strathmore Capital Advisors Inc. acquired a new position in shares of Simon Property Group, Inc. (NYSE:SPGFree Report) in the second qu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m acquired 3,808 shares of the real estate investment trust’s stock, valued at approximately $864,000. Simon Property Group makes up approximately 0.2% of Strathmore Capital Advisors Inc.’s holdings, making the stock its 28th biggest position.

Simon Property Group Price Performance

Shares of SPG opened at $223.20 on Thursday. The company has a current ratio of 1.05, a quick ratio of 1.05 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 5.19. The company’s fifty day simple moving average is $222.96 and its 200 day simple moving average is $206.84. Simon Property Group, Inc. has a 1-year low of $172.19 and a 1-year high of $238.50. The company has a market cap of $72.22 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 15.74, a PEG ratio of 2.75 and a beta of 1.30.

Simon Property Group (NYSE:SPGG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Monday, August 10th. The real estate investment trust reported $1.49 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.64 by ($0.15). Simon Property Group had a net margin of 66.56% and a return on equity of 89.32%. The firm had revenue of $1.79 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.61 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business earned $1.70 EPS. The business’s revenue was up 19.5% compared to the same quarter last year. Simon Property Group has set its FY 2026 guidance at 13.200-13.300 EPS. On average, research analysts forecast that Simon Property Group, Inc. will post 13.2 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Simon Property Group Announces Dividend

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, September 30th. Shareholders of record on Wednesday, September 9th will be given a dividend of $2.25 per share. This represents a $9.00 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 4.0%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, September 9th. Simon Property Group’s payout ratio is 63.47%.

About Simon Property Group

Simon Property Group, Inc (NYSE: SPG) is a publicly traded real estate investment trust (REIT) that owns, develops and manages retail real estate properties. Its core business activities include acquisition, development, leasing and property management of regional malls, outlet centers and mixed‑use retail destinations. The company operates retail brands that include high‑profile regional shopping centers and the Premium Outlets platform, and it provides services such as tenant leasing, marketing, property operations and capital projects to optimize asset performance.

Simon’s portfolio spans a broad mix of enclosed malls, open‑air centers, outlet properties and mixed‑use developments, and the company pursues redevelopment and repositioning to adapt properties to changing consumer and retail trends.
